Water heater installation cost by job.

Installed-labor pricing for Sylacauga, adjusted for local rates. Relocations and gas-line upgrades add to the base.

In Sylacauga, Alabama, water heater installation costs typically range from $600 to $1,400 for a standard tank unit, and $1,400 to $3,400+ for a tankless system. With a median home age of 54 years, many homes may need updates to meet current code, including expansion tanks on closed systems. Local permits are required, and plumbers must be state-licensed. Given the humid subtropical climate and mostly electric water heating, a heat pump water heater is a strong fit, and the federal 25C tax credit (30%, up to $2,000) can offset costs for qualifying units.

What Sylacauga code requires

Replacing a water heater in Sylacauga follows Alabama rules under the International Plumbing Code (IPC). Here’s what applies statewide:

  • Permit

    Pulled by your licensed plumber; covers gas/venting and the expansion tank.

    Required
  • Seismic strapping

    No state strapping mandate — one less line on the bill.

    Not required
  • Expansion tank

    Required where a pressure regulator or backflow preventer is present.

    Required on closed systems (check valve, PRV, or backflow preventer present)
  • Plumbing code
    International Plumbing Code (IPC)
  • Good to know

    Plumbers must be licensed by the state Plumbers and Gas Fitters Examining Board; permit requirements and inspections are handled at the local jurisdiction level.

What moves the price

What affects installation costs in Sylacauga

Installation costs vary based on unit type (tank vs. tankless), fuel source changes (e.g., adding a gas line for $225–$750), and code requirements like expansion tanks on closed systems. Older homes (median built 1972) may need additional labor for venting or electrical upgrades. Permit fees and local inspection requirements also add to the total. Choosing a heat pump water heater can qualify for federal tax credits, potentially lowering net cost.

Common water heater installation issues in Sylacauga

1

Expansion tank requirement

Alabama code requires an expansion tank on closed systems (with check valve, PRV, or backflow preventer). Many older Sylacauga homes may need this added during installation.

2

Permit and inspection delays

Permits are required and handled locally. Scheduling inspections can extend the installation timeline, especially in smaller markets like Sylacauga.

3

Older home compatibility

With a median home age of 54 years, existing plumbing, electrical, or gas lines may need upgrades to support a new water heater, increasing labor and material costs.
